Three ways Liverpool can produce a Champions League miracle vs PSG at Anfield
"Anfield is still one of the most daunting challenges for any visiting side, particularly in the latter stages of the Champions League. Major clubs like Barcelona and Chelsea have experienced the power of a truly unleashed Anfield."
"The key is the Reds getting off to a fast start in the match. If they can score first, the pressure will fall squarely on the PSG players and it will only heighten from that point on."
"The defensive approach we saw in the first leg must be abandoned for a more front-foot mindset that allows our many gifted attackers to flex their creative muscles."
Liverpool faces PSG in the Champions League Quarterfinals, trailing 2-0 on aggregate. A recent victory over Fulham provides some momentum. To succeed, Liverpool must leverage the Anfield atmosphere, which has historically intimidated top teams. A fast start is crucial to shift pressure onto PSG. The team needs to abandon a defensive strategy in favor of an attacking mindset, allowing their talented players to showcase their skills and energize the home crowd.
